      or, How Clear Grit Won the Day by Captain Alan Douglas is a captivating story centered around a group of Boy Scouts from Hickory Ridge. The narrative unfolds with the scouts embarking on a camping trip along the Sweetwater River, eager to enjoy the last days of summer. The group includes Elmer Chenowith, the patrol leader, and his friends Ty Collins, Landy Smith, Ted Burgoyne, and the new recruit, Adam Litzburgh, whose German background adds a new dynamic to the group. The story begins with the boys enjoying a swim, where Adam surprises everyone with his exceptional diving skills, dispelling any initial doubts about his abilities. The plot thickens when Landy accidentally comes into contact with a plant that causes a severe allergic reaction, initially feared to be poison ivy. However, with the quick intervention of Ted, the troop's budding medic, Landy's condition is managed effectively, showcasing the scouts' resourcefulness and teamwork. The narrative takes a humorous turn when Ty, known for his attachment to a bright red sweater, finds himself trapped in a tree by an aggressive bull, attracted by the sweater's color. The scouts rally to devise a clever plan to distract the bull, allowing Ty to escape unharmed, albeit at the cost of his beloved sweater. This incident underscores the themes of friendship and quick thinking that are prevalent throughout the story. As the scouts navigate these challenges, they learn valuable lessons about nature, survival, and the importance of supporting one another. The story is a testament to the spirit of scouting, emphasizing courage, camaraderie, and the joy of outdoor adventures....
